We’ve had to cut the odds after a surge of bets on both Manchester City and Liverpool to win their remaining five games in this fascinating finale to the Premier League season.

Betfred were 14/1 but are now 11/1 that this happens – and of course that would mean City retaining the title and a huge relief to me having shelled out £750,000 on them doing so before Christmas.
